AI-Enhanced Sound Design and Synthesis


1. Research and Development Phase


1.1 Identify Objectives

Define the specific goals for sound design and synthesis, such as creating unique soundscapes or enhancing audio quality.


1.2 Explore AI Tools

Investigate available AI-driven audio tools that can assist in achieving the objectives. Examples include:

  • iZotope Ozone: AI-assisted mastering tool that optimizes audio tracks.
  • LANDR: AI-driven platform for instant mastering and sound enhancement.
  • Adobe Audition: Incorporates AI features for noise reduction and audio repair.

2. Sound Design Process


2.1 Collect Audio Samples

Gather a diverse range of audio samples from various sources, including field recordings, instruments, and synthesized sounds.


2.2 Utilize AI for Sound Generation

Implement AI algorithms to generate new sounds. Tools such as:

  • Endlesss: Collaborative music-making platform with AI-generated loops.
  • AIVA: AI composer that creates original music based on user-defined parameters.

2.3 Apply AI for Sound Manipulation

Use AI tools for sound manipulation techniques, such as:

  • Sonible Smart:EQ: An AI-driven equalizer that analyzes audio and suggests optimal EQ settings.
  • Melodyne: AI-assisted pitch correction and audio editing software.

3. Synthesis Phase


3.1 Synthesize Sounds

Employ AI-driven synthesizers to create unique sounds. Tools include:

  • Arturia Pigments: A powerful software synthesizer that integrates AI for sound design.
  • Google Magenta: Open-source project that explores machine learning in music generation.

3.2 Experiment with AI-Driven Effects

Incorporate AI-driven effects to enhance synthesized sounds, such as:

  • Eventide H910 Harmonizer: AI-enhanced pitch-shifting and harmonization effects.
  • Waves Clarity Vx: AI-powered vocal isolation and enhancement tool.
